Dd has been teething, so I got some of these, and in the past three days (since I've started giving them to her) she's puked three times. I've given her the tablets three times. No fever, and she is acting happy and healthy (other than occasional teething pain).
She is exclusively breastfed, I'm not eating anything unusual, and she's never vomited before this. I'm assuming it's the Hylands tablets.
Has anyone else had this experience?

Also, the tablets themselves have a lactose base and I've seen lactose intolerant kids who couldn't handle even the small amount in the tablets. Could this be a possibility?
